To prevent the jelly from becoming cloudy, do not press on the grapes while straining. Allow the juice to naturally strain out until you have at least 7 cups juice, at least 2 hours and up to 4 hours.

Concord grape jelly from bottled grape juice. Sometimes bottled grape juice will have other juices added. That’s OK but the only thing in the bottle should be 100% juice, no sugar added.
